With regard to the fascinating world of specialist wrestling, championship belts act as tangible personifications of a rival's trip, their triumphs, and their status as the most effective in their domain name. Amongst the huge variety of titles that have enhanced the shoulders of wrestling icons, the Big Gold Belt stands as a particularly prized and promptly identifiable icon of reputation. Greater than simply a item of luxuriant steel and natural leather, the Big Gold Belt stands for a abundant history, a lineage of epic champions, and a requirement of excellence that goes beyond promotions and periods.

Originally appointed in 1985 for the National Wrestling Partnership (NWA) Whole World Heavyweight Champion Ric Panache, the Big Gold Belt quickly ended up being identified with whole world championship caliber. Its extravagant layout, featuring 3 huge, delicately in-depth gold plates and a distinctive nameplate for personalization, established it apart as a reward of significant splendour. For many years, the Big Gold Belt has actually represented not just the NWA Whole World Heavyweight Champion but additionally the copyright Whole world Heavyweight Championship and, later on, the copyright Globe Heavyweight Champion, solidifying its area as one of the most iconic and desired rewards in professional wrestling history.

The Birth and Iconic Design of the Huge Gold Belt.
The genesis of the Large Gold Belt is a fascinating tale including silversmith Charles Crumrine, renowned for his rodeo-style belt clasps. Commissioned by Jim Crockett Promotions (JCP) to create a brand-new, extra impressive title for their leading champion, Crumrine crafted a work of art. The key elements of the Huge Gold Belt's design added to its immediate and lasting effect:.

Wonderful Gold Plates: The three primary plates of the belt were substantial and crafted from gold-plated sterling silver. The detailed inscriptions included timeless fumbling images, consisting of grappling figures, a regal crown, and ornate scrollwork, all adding to a feeling of ageless prestige.
Personalized Nameplate: A important and special feature of the Large Gold Belt was the addition of a popular nameplate beneath the central style. This permitted the champion's name to be engraved directly onto the belt, additional stressing their private accomplishment and link to the title.
Extravagant Natural Leather Strap: At first featuring a cordovan leather band, the Big Gold Belt later transitioned to a black leather band. The high quality of the natural leather included in the general sense of high-end and value.
Absence of a Central Logo design: Unlike numerous other champion belts that prominently present a promotion's logo, the Big Gold Belt's emphasis got on the images of fumbling and champion itself. This added to its convenience and permitted it to perfectly represent different companies over time.
The Big Gold Belt's design was a deliberate action away from the a lot more cartoonish or overtly top quality belts of the era, establishing a look of traditional beauty and indisputable significance.

A Icon of Championship Pedigree Throughout Promotions.
What makes the Huge Gold Belt so distinct is its journey across different major wrestling promotions, each time representing their most prominent whole world champion:.

NWA Whole World Heavyweight Champion (1986-1991): The Large Gold Belt debuted as the NWA Whole World Heavyweight Champion, replacing the " 10 Pounds of Gold." It was quickly related to the fabulous Ric Style, that brought it with unequaled charm and assisted develop its legendary condition.
copyright Entire World Heavyweight Championship (1991, 1994-2001): When copyright escaped from the NWA, the Big Gold Belt continued to represent their top champion. Symbols like Sting, Hunk Hogan, Goldberg, and Ruby Dallas Page all held this version of the title, further cementing its legacy.
" The Real World Champion" (WWF, 1991-1993): In a debatable however unforgettable moment, Ric Panache brought the Huge Gold Belt to the WWF after a dispute with copyright. While the WWF created a similar-looking " Large Gold" replica, the initial belt was commonly referred to as the " Real Life Championship," including another chapter to its storied history.
copyright Entire World Heavyweight Champion (2002-2013): Adhering to copyright's acquisition of copyright, the Big Gold Belt was eventually reestablished as the copyright World Heavyweight Champion throughout the brand split period. This model saw legendary numbers like Three-way H, Shawn Michaels, The Undertaker, and John Cena hold the title, attaching it with a brand-new generation of wrestling fans.
This journey throughout promotions strengthened the Large Gold Belt's track record as a symbol of world-class wrestling, no matter the banner under which it was defended.

The Enduring Attraction and Legacy of the Big Gold Belt.
Also after its main retirement in copyright in 2013, the Big Gold Belt remains to hold a unique place in the hearts of battling fans. Its enduring allure can be credited to a number of factors:.

Nostalgia: For numerous fans, the Big Gold Belt is inherently linked to some of their favored ages and wrestlers. It evokes memories of traditional suits, fascinating stories, and epic personalities.
Classic Design: The timeless and stylish style of the belt has actually matured extremely well. Unlike some big gold belt more cartoonish or trend-driven layouts, the Big Gold Belt radiates a feeling of sustaining status.
Association with Legends: The sheer variety of fabulous champs who have actually held the Huge Gold Belt has raised its status to that of a truly iconic prize. It stands for a lineage of the greatest in professional fumbling.
A Icon of True Championship: The Big Gold Belt has actually constantly seemed like a "world heavyweight championship" in its purest form, lacking the overt branding of certain promotions and focusing instead on the fundamental stature of being the leading champion.
The Big Gold Belt stays a prominent design for reproduction belts and merchandise, a testimony to its enduring effect on wrestling society. Its picture is often made use of in historic retrospectives and conversations about the greatest champion belts of perpetuity.
